Livestock Transport Services for Farms, Markets and Agricultural Businesses

Livestock transport involves far more than simply loading animals onto a vehicle and driving to the destination. Every movement requires consideration of journey times, vehicle suitability, animal welfare requirements, handling procedures and legal obligations.

Professional livestock hauliers transport cattle, sheep, pigs, goats, poultry and other farm animals between farms, livestock markets, collection centres, breeding facilities, export points and processing sites. Many operators also provide support with movement scheduling and route planning to help minimise journey times and reduce unnecessary stress on animals.

Animal welfare during transport is heavily regulated. Farmers and transport operators should be familiar with the official guidance provided by GOV.UK regarding welfare of animals during transport. These requirements cover fitness for transport, journey planning, loading procedures, rest periods and the responsibilities of transporters.

Understanding Animal Transport Regulations

Businesses involved in livestock movements must ensure the correct authorisations and qualifications are in place. Depending on journey length and circumstances, transporters may require an animal transporter authorisation and staff handling animals may need a recognised certificate of competence.

Official guidance on obtaining an animal transporter authorisation is available through GOV.UK. Additional information regarding transporter responsibilities and qualifications can also be found within the wider animal welfare guidance.

Experienced livestock operators understand these obligations and maintain the necessary documentation, training records and operational procedures required by regulators.

Approved Vehicles and Animal Welfare Standards

Vehicles used for livestock transport must be suitable for the species being moved and maintained to a high standard. Proper ventilation, secure partitions, suitable flooring and safe loading ramps all contribute to animal welfare and operational safety.

Stocking densities are another important consideration. Overcrowding can increase stress levels and raise welfare concerns, while underutilising vehicle capacity can increase transport costs unnecessarily. Experienced livestock hauliers understand the appropriate loading levels for different species, sizes and journey durations.

Journey planning is equally important. Factors such as weather conditions, roadworks, ferry schedules and expected traffic can all affect travel times. Good operators plan routes carefully and build contingencies into schedules where necessary.

Cleansing and Disinfection Requirements

One area often overlooked by businesses new to livestock movements is vehicle cleansing and disinfection. Vehicles transporting animals must be thoroughly cleaned between loads to help reduce biosecurity risks and prevent disease transmission.

Professional operators typically operate documented cleaning procedures and maintain records where required. Farms and agricultural businesses should not hesitate to ask transport providers how cleansing and disinfection are managed between journeys.

Transport Beyond Livestock

Many agricultural transport companies provide services beyond animal movements. It is common for rural operators to handle multiple types of agricultural freight throughout the year.

Alongside livestock transport, many businesses also move:

  • Grain and cereals
  • Animal feed and feed ingredients
  • Fertilisers and agricultural inputs
  • Hay, straw and forage products
  • Farm machinery and equipment
  • Bulk agricultural commodities

How to Judge a Livestock Haulier

Not all transport providers have the same level of agricultural experience. When selecting a livestock transport company, look beyond the quoted price and assess the overall quality of the service being offered.

Questions worth asking include:

  • How long has the company been transporting livestock?
  • Do drivers hold the appropriate certificates of competence?
  • Are vehicles designed specifically for livestock movements?
  • How are animal welfare and journey planning managed?
  • What cleansing and disinfection procedures are followed?
  • Can they provide references from farms or agricultural customers?
  • Do they regularly transport the species you need moved?

Experienced operators are usually happy to discuss their procedures and explain how they manage welfare, compliance and biosecurity requirements.

What Affects Livestock Transport Pricing?

Livestock transport pricing varies considerably depending on the nature of the movement. Distance remains one of the biggest factors, but it is far from the only consideration.

Costs may be influenced by:

  • Species and number of animals being transported
  • Collection and delivery locations
  • Journey duration and route complexity
  • Vehicle type and specialist equipment requirements
  • Loading and unloading arrangements
  • Waiting times at farms, marts or abattoirs
  • Seasonal demand and vehicle availability

Obtaining several quotations often provides a clearer picture of market rates while helping identify operators with the most suitable experience.
